A note about the design: My mother (who taught me how to sew) made a lot of my clothing when I was a child and one of my favorites was a jumper with a very similar flower motif, with simple flowers and trim and ric-rac for the stems which she appliqued onto the front. So these backpacks are a kind of homage to her. And yes, I made a backpack for myself! Makes me happy every time I use it.
